Green Forest was not able to break out of their rough patch on Thursday as the team picked up their fifth straight defeat. They fell 7-3 to Valley Springs. The home team had taken home the W every time these teams have met since April 10, 2023, but that streak is no more.
Mason Meador was cooking despite his team's loss, scoring two runs and stealing a base while getting on base in all four of his plate appearances.
Green Forest's loss dropped their record down to 1-5. As for Valley Springs, the victory was the third in a row for them, bringing their record for this year to 3-2.
